Ocean County residents with appointments to be vaccinated for the coronavirus Monday will have their appointments moved to next week, the Ocean County Health Department announced. This announcement applies to those who had appointments at the department’s vaccination site at Toms River High School North.
Any appointments scheduled for Monday, Feb. 1 will be honored at the remaining Toms River North clinics this week: Tuesday (Feb. 2) through Friday (Feb. 5th) from 1 p.m. to 4 p.m. or Saturday (Feb. 6th) from 9 a.m. to 1 p.m.
“Please bring your printed registration form or documentation of your appointment confirmation with you to the clinic,” the notice said.
